There is not a whole lot of change this time - there are some further
changes which are in the works, but those will be held over until next
time.

Here there are some clean ups to inode creation, the addition of an
origin (local or remote) indicator to glock demote requests, removal
of one of the remaining GFP_NOFAIL allocations during log flushes,
one minor clean up, and a one liner bug fix.
